Transaction 26333cd98168983534ca57395eeb757b97e054f8e9678eb8ebe6f55d3f71e56a

1 Input
1 Outputs
  • 26333cd98168983534ca57395eeb757b97e054f8e9678eb8ebe6f55d3f71e56a:0
  • value  829000
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c